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
224396937 8312115877 6259173829 89190919373 138215
41952 749915 6601734
41952 749915 6601734
5979743070 3554 89131957 78464
All about undefined
Interested in learning more?
41952 749915 6601734
5979743070 3554 89131957 78464
See more
83007851669 184038291 37177749974
48911034 33 393 961
See more
3796217171 21
365642 8493 0878 40206911
See more